Al-Aradah concludes the second phase of the street lighting project in several areas of Marib city.

Major Milestone in Marib: Lighting Project Completed

Marib Governor Celebrates Completion of Phase Two

Marib Governor, Major General Sultan al-Arada, has successfully concluded the second phase of a street lighting project in Marib City. This initiative, funded by the local authority, coincides with the celebration of the 57th anniversary of national independence on November 30.

Project Details and Implementation

The second phase of the project focused on illuminating the southern entrance of Marib City, along with several main and secondary streets. The project utilized high-efficiency lighting systems to ensure sustainability and reduce energy consumption.

During a field visit to inspect the newly lit streets, Governor al-Arada emphasized the significance of this project. He stated that it enhances the urban and aesthetic appeal of the city while reflecting the level of development in infrastructure and essential services. This improvement aligns with the rapid urban expansion and population growth in the governorate.
